Phone Number For Kapaa Photovoltaic Project

Phone Number For Kapaa Photovoltaic Project

Address, Phone Number, and Hours for Kapaa Photovoltaic Project, an Power Plants, at Kapaa.

Name : Kapaa Photovoltaic Project

Address : Lot No. 2 Of Tax Map Key (4)4- Kapaa, Hawaii, 96746

Locality : Kapaa

Map of Kapaa Photovoltaic Project

View map of Kapaa Photovoltaic Project get driving directions from your location.